Output 66a60ca76ef9bf3fc939ba6989e684d28835164744c7cd20f4d7c2339b5a84b0:0

value
338672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5750ef2777214225342f009ac08eb223ab955bbb OP_EQUAL
address
2N1CujNydBNzjp89bHNzRdHX8qDu9cAFfNH
transaction
66a60ca76ef9bf3fc939ba6989e684d28835164744c7cd20f4d7c2339b5a84b0
spent
true